Alternatively, the self-contained source tarball is at >> http://www.sagemath.org/download-latest.html >> >> As mentioned before, there are no incremental updates from 6.x. You need >> to compile from scratch, e.g. after cleaning with "make distclean" or "git >> clean -f -d -x".
